Setting up the various kitchen design ideas mentioned above involves a combination of design elements, materials, and layout considerations. Here’s how you can implement some of these ideas in your kitchen:

Minimalist Marvel:

Use a neutral color palette with white or light gray cabinets and countertops.
Opt for sleek, handleless cabinet doors for a clean look.
Choose simple, geometric hardware and fixtures.
Keep countertops clutter-free and maintain a minimalist decor theme.

Open Shelving Charm:

Install floating shelves made of wood, metal, or glass.
Display colorful plates, bowls, and glassware for visual interest.
Mix in potted herbs or small plants to add a touch of greenery.

Rustic Retreat:

Incorporate exposed brick walls or use brick-style tiles for backsplashes.
Install wooden ceiling beams or wooden flooring for a rustic feel.
Decorate with vintage kitchen utensils and distressed furniture.

Industrial Chic:

Use stainless steel appliances and fixtures for an industrial look.
Opt for concrete countertops or floors to enhance the raw aesthetic.
Expose ductwork or pipes for an authentic industrial vibe.

Bold Backsplashes:

Choose patterned or colorful tiles for the backsplash.
Create a mosaic design with a mix of small and large tiles.
Install LED strip lighting under cabinets to highlight the backsplash.

Farmhouse Fantasy:

Select shaker-style cabinets in a soft, pastel color.
Use an apron-front sink and traditional faucet.
Decorate with checkered patterns, mason jars, and vintage-inspired decor.

Modern Monochrome:

Pair black and white cabinets for a stark contrast.
Use high-gloss finishes for a contemporary look.
Incorporate minimalist bar stools and pendant lighting.

Pop of Color:

Choose one bold color for cabinet doors or an accent wall.
Use colorful bar stools, light fixtures, or small appliances.

Island Oasis:

Install a large kitchen island with a countertop for food preparation.
Add bar seating to the island for casual dining.
Incorporate storage shelves or drawers within the island.

Nature’s Touch:

Use natural stone or wood for countertops and backsplashes.
Decorate with potted plants, succulents, and fresh flowers.
Install large windows to bring in plenty of natural light and outdoor views.

Smart Solutions:

Integrate smart appliances with wireless connectivity.
Use hidden charging stations built into the kitchen island or countertops.
Install under-cabinet lighting that can be controlled via a smart device.

Luxurious Marble:

Choose marble countertops with elegant veining patterns.
Incorporate marble accents in the form of coasters, trays, or cutting boards.
Use neutral colors for cabinets and walls to complement the marble.

Vintage Vibes:

Select retro-style appliances in pastel colors.
Use vintage-inspired tiles for the backsplash.
Decorate with retro signage, old-fashioned cookware, and vintage decor.

Cottage Core:

Choose soft, pastel colors for cabinets and walls.
Use floral patterns for curtains, seat cushions, or dishware.
Decorate with woven baskets, decorative plates, and antique touches.

Sleek and Streamlined:

Opt for handleless cabinets with push-to-open mechanisms.
Install integrated appliances that blend seamlessly with cabinets.
Use a monochromatic color scheme to maintain a sleek appearance.

Eco-Friendly Elegance:

Choose sustainable materials like bamboo for cabinets or recycled glass for countertops.
Install energy-efficient appliances and LED lighting.
Decorate with eco-friendly accessories made from reclaimed materials.

Glamorous Gold:

Incorporate gold hardware, faucets, and light fixtures.
Choose cabinets with a glossy metallic finish.
Use mirrors strategically to reflect and enhance the gold accents.

Artistic Flair:

Create a custom mosaic or painted backsplash with unique designs.
Hang artwork or decorative plates on the kitchen walls.
Install open shelves to display artistic pottery or sculptures.

Transitional Charm:

Combine traditional elements like crown molding with modern fixtures.
Choose neutral colors with a mix of warm and cool tones.
Incorporate both open shelves and closed cabinets for a balanced look.

French Countryside:

Use distressed cabinets with intricate details.
Install a farmhouse sink and decorative faucet.
Decorate with lavender, French country fabrics, and rustic accessories.
